Both the Escambia Academy Cougars and Escambia County High School Blue Devils fell in the postseason last week, ending their seasons.

The Cougars saw their season come to an end Thursday night, as they fell at Glenwood Schools 61-36 in the AISA Class AAA semifinals.

Garrett Kirk had 15 points to lead the Cougars (13-12). Dalton Walker led Glenwood with 17 points.
ECHS fell in the semifinals of the Class 5A, Area 2, tournament on Wednesday, Feb. 4.

The Blue Devils (12-16) took a hard-fought 63-57 overtime loss to Jackson in the tournament, which was hosted by Vigor High School.

Malik McMillan led ECHS with 15 points, and Triston Knott added 14. Darren McMullen led the Aggies with 18 points.

The ECHS Lady Blue Devils also lost their first game in the area tournament, dropping a tough 44-43 defeat to Jackson on Tuesday, Feb. 3.
